Egerton University stopped from punishing dons over strike

Egerton University lecturers led by Universities Academic Staff Union (UASU) Nakuru chapter secretary Grace Kibue (centre) and chapter chairperson Prof Mwaniki Ngari (left) singing solidarity songs before addressing the press at their office in Nakuru on December 22, 2021.[Kipsang Joseph, Standard]

The Employment and Labour Relations Court has barred Egerton University from instituting disciplinary action against union leaders over the ongoing strike.
